Showing Page:
1/30
COMSATS University Islamabad, Lahore Campus
Department of Electrical and Computer Engineering
FYP-II Progress Report
Project Title
SMART SHOPPING TROLLEY
Project Supervisor
NISMA SALEEM
Group
Members
Name
Email Address
ADNAN HASSAN
adnanha236267@gmail.com
ZOHAIB AHMAD
za890346@gmail.com
RANA
MOHAMMAD
AYMAD QAYYUM
ahmadqayyum19@gmail.com
NOMAN FAROOQ
noman.alvi987@gmail.com
Department of Electrical and Computer Engineering
COMSATS University Islamabad
LAHORE Campus PAKISTAN
Showing Page:
2/30
Table of Contents
1. INTRODUCTION .................................................................................................................................. 5
1.1. Aim of Project ..................................................................................................................... 6
1.2. Smart Shopping Trolley Design. ........................................................................................ 7
1.2.1. Electrical ........................................................................................................................ 7
1.2.2. Software ........................................................................................................................ 7
1.3. Objectives ........................................................................................................................... 7
1.4. Chapters Breakdown ........................................................................................................... 7
1.5. Conclusion .......................................................................................................................... 7
2. LITERATURE REVIEW ...................................................................................................................... 9
2.1. History / Background .......................................................................................................... 9
2.2 Manual System .................................................................................................................. 10
2.2.1 Product availability ...................................................................................................... 10
2.2.2 Product location ........................................................................................................... 10
2.2.3 Barcode scanner .......................................................................................................... 10
2.2.4 Bill Payment ................................................................................................................. 11
2.3 Advancement in System .................................................................................................... 11
2.3.1. Shopping trolley based on QR Code ........................................................................... 11
2.3.2. Shopping trolley based on Camera and Barcode........................................................ 12
2.3.3. Shopping trolley based on RFID .................................................................................. 12
2.3.4. Shopping trolley based on website ............................................................................. 14
2.3.5 Online Shopping ........................................................................................................... 14
2.3.6 Location Tracking of Product ...................................................................................... 14
2.4. Smart Shopping Trolley .................................................................................................... 15
2.4.1. Product Searching and Location ................................................................................. 15
2.4.2. Barcode Scanner Mounted on Trolley ........................................................................ 15
2.4.3. Anti-theft Technique ................................................................................................... 16
2.4.4. Multi-Tasking .............................................................................................................. 17
3. PROJECT DESIGN ............................................................................................................................. 18
3.1. Electrical ............................................................................................................................ 18
3.1.1. Raspberry Pi 3 .............................................................................................................. 18
Showing Page:
3/30
3.1.2. Barcode Scanner ...................................................................................................... 19
3.1.3. LCD with Touch Screen............................................................................................. 20
3.1.4. Shopping Cart ........................................................................................................... 20
3.1.5. Weight Sensor .......................................................................................................... 21
3.2. Software ........................................................................................................................... 21
3.2.1. XAMPP ...................................................................................................................... 21
3.2.2. phpMyAdmin ........................................................................................................... 21
3.2.3. Visual Studio ............................................................................................................. 21
4. IMPLEMENTATION .......................................................................................................................... 22
4.1. Hardware Interfacing ........................................................................................................ 22
4.1.1. Design Flowchart ....................................................................................................... 23
4.2. Developing Graphical User Interface ................................................................................ 24
4.2.1. tkinter ......................................................................................................................... 24
4.2.2. wxPython .................................................................................................................... 24
4.2.3 Visual Studio ................................................................................................................ 25
5. REFERENCES ..................................................................................................................................... 28
Showing Page:
4/30
Table of Figures
Figure 1.1: Shopping Mall ............................................................................................................. 5
Figure 1.2: Problems in shopping .................................................................................................. 6
Figure 2.1: Departmental Store .……………………………………………………………..…….9
Figure 2.2 :Shopping trolley in Malls ............................................................................................. 9
Figure 2.3: Searching of a Product ............................................................................................... 10
Figure 2. 4:Barcode Scanner on counter ....................................................................................... 11
Figure 2.5: Shopping mall counter................................................................................................ 11
Figure 2. 6: QR Code Scanner ...................................................................................................... 12
Figure 2.7: Barcode Scanner ......................................................................................................... 12
Figure 2.8: RFID based Trolley image ......................................................................................... 13
Figure 2.9: Flow chart of RFID based trolley ............................................................................... 13
Figure 2. 10: Online shopping ...................................................................................................... 14
Figure 2.11: Classification of Indoor positioning Technique ....................................................... 15
Figure 2. 12: Barcode mounted on Trolley ................................................................................... 16
Figure 3.1: Raspberry-Pi-3 ……………………………………………………………………..19
Figure 3.2: Barcode Scanner ........................................................................................................ 19
Figure 3.3: LCD Touch Screen .................................................................................................... 20
Figure 3.4: Shopping Trolley ....................................................................................................... 20
Figure 4.1: Design Flowchart……………………………………………………………………23
Figure 4.2: tkinter GUI ................................................................................................................. 24
Figure 4.3: wxPython User Interface ............................................................................................ 25
Figure 4.4: Visual Display GUI ................................................................................................... 25
Figure 4.5: Purchased Items ......................................................................................................... 26
Figure 4.6: Remove items ............................................................................................................ 26
Figure 4.7: Shopping List ............................................................................................................ 27
Showing Page:
5/30